Check out these new seats from Corbeau. They fit inside the S2000 well! So if you are looking for a seat that is more comfy than the stock seats, these may be for you. They retail for less than $1,000 for a pair.
As you can see they sit a little lower than the stock seats.
Some pictures of the clearance on the door panel, center console and middle compartment.

#1768
They're honestly shit.
Mine creaks and isn't very stable, but that's the price I pay for literally sitting on the floor of the car. I could've went with a Planted seat rail/slider combo but it doesn't allow a really low seated position.
